What is AppSync?
Protecting Your Device with AppSync: Ensuring App Security and Up-to-date Synchronization for iOS Devices
AppSync is a versatile and resilient service offered by Amazon Web Services (AWS) that streamlines and simplifies application development by allowing developers to create flexible APIs for securely accessing, manipulating, and combining data from multiple sources. It's essential to understand
AppSync in the context of
cybersecurity and
antivirus as it makes data access and manipulation more secured, reducing the risk of
data breaches and threats.
AppSync can be conceptualized as a managed service that extends and enhances the capabilities of GraphQL for serverless computing. This platform is a query language for APIs and acts as a runtime environment to execute the queries. AppSync synchronizes application data across networked devices in real time or utilizes offline data sync via AWS.
The role of AppSync in safeguarding cybersecurity within a cloud infrastructure cannot be over-emphasized. It specialises in managing user data being migrated via a Graph Query Language (GraphQL) interface. GraphQL, unlike REST APIs, reduces vulnerabilities that arise from traditional REST APIs, like under or over-fetching, which can potentially expose data. GraphQL allows clients to specify exactly what data is needed, which developers find great as it makes APIs easier to design, while also improving performance by reducing server resource consumption.
In the context of antivirus, each of these coordinated connections benefits significantly from AppSync's serverless backend. Not merely because an impenetrable shield is put up against malware, but its highly secure, scalable GraphQL service gives considerable durability and adaptability in hostile situations, especially during suspicious transactions across APIs. The capability of GraphQL APIs to control exactly what data is pulled and when can effectively reduce the attack surface, complicating potential cybercriminal strategies to infect systems with malware.
AppSync shielding mechanisms are compatible with AWS Identity and Access Management (IAM) and Amazon Cognito, which helps hit multiple cybersecurity aims. IAM helps to securely control access to AWS services and resources for your users. Using IAM, you can create and manage AWS users and groups, and use permissions to control AWS who has access to what. Further, with Amazon Cognito, the users gain temporary, limited-privilege AWS credentials to align with user authorizations, thus preventing
unauthorized data access. It prevents overgranted permissions and ensures only necessary access is given, leading to a highly effective preventive to potential cyber breaches and providing a more secure environment for APIs and software application developments.
AppSync service also includes built-in conflict resolution for data consistency, automated tracking for multiple multiple data sources, real-time event subscriptions, and directlambda resolvers (standard AWS Lambda function to solve for data closer to a client, ensuring speedier data access). with GraphQL schemas being intricate in design and bundled with direct resolvers, this cyber secure fast-response service often results in eliminating threats that may encroach upon a router requesting access to sensitive or classified data.
In line with securing crucial data across your applications, Amazon Appsync provisions cybersecurity and antivirus measures at the highest level with shielding like AWS Key Management Service, Array Level authorization, built-in
DDoS protection, and more. It operates a process model in shielding your data at every handling point by executing consistent automated cybersecurity surveillance that keeps monitoring encryption keys and algorithms.
To sum up, Amazon AppSync is the reliable amalgamation of application development and robust cyber secure protocols. It complements structured frameworks that function as a solid foundation for cybersecurity and antivirus. Along with continuing client data fetching, these professional defensive operations make AppSync a critical investment for your application’s secured development operation premise. Its crucial role in contemporary
cloud computing infrastructure manifests itself by integrating with AWS's routinely updated behavior against emerging cyber challenges, mainly through responding to potential threats swiftly and accurately with backed up strong
patching culture.
AppSync FAQs
What is AWS AppSync and how it can help in cybersecurity?
AWS AppSync is a managed service provided by Amazon Web Services (AWS) that enables developers to build scalable and secure applications quickly. It uses GraphQL APIs to simplify data transfers between the client and server, and its serverless architecture makes it a great tool for building secure, cloud-based applications. With AppSync, developers can easily build end-to-end encrypted applications that help to enhance cybersecurity.What are the benefits of using AppSync in antivirus software?
Antivirus software requires up-to-date threat intelligence and immediate response to threats to provide robust cybersecurity. AWS AppSync can help simplify the process of capturing threat intelligence and responding to threats. By enabling real-time data synchronization between endpoints, AppSync ensures that antivirus software has access to the latest threat intelligence data, making it easier to detect and isolate malware attacks. It can also be used by security teams to perform analytics on security data, providing insights into security trends and emerging threats.How does AppSync ensure data security in an application?
AppSync has several built-in features that enable developers to build secure applications. First, AppSync provides end-to-end encryption, ensuring that data is protected in transit and at rest. Second, AppSync uses IAM, Cognito, and other AWS security services to control access to resources, ensuring that only authorized users can access sensitive data. Finally, AppSync provides DDoS protection, shielding applications from malicious traffic that can disrupt services and lead to data breaches.How can developers use AppSync to build scalable and secure applications?
Developers can use AppSync to build serverless applications quickly and easily. With AppSync, developers have access to a wide range of AWS services, including Lambda, DynamoDB, and S3, to build secure and scalable applications. AppSync also provides real-time data synchronization, enabling developers to build applications that can handle large-scale data transfers in real-time. By using AppSync, developers can focus on building innovative security features and leave the infrastructure and security management to AWS.